Located in the picturesque region of Instow, near Barnstaple in Devon, Oak Tree Cottage offers a delightful retreat for up to four guests. This charming cottage features a private sitting-out area perfect for summer al fresco dining. Inside, the living room and dining area boast a wooden floor and patio doors that lead to the garden, enhancing the connection with the outdoors. The compact kitchen is well-equipped, while the accommodation includes a double bedroom, a twin bedroom, and a bathroom with a shower attachment. The cottage is fully heated with gas central heating, and additional amenities include electricity, bed linen, towels, and modern appliances such as a Freeview TV, DVD player, microwave, washing machine, and dishwasher.

The location serves as an excellent base for holidaymakers eager to explore the stunning Devon coastline and countryside. The surrounding area is rich in opportunities for outdoor activities, making it an ideal choice for those who enjoy water sports, sailing, and fishing. The charming village of Instow is nearby, featuring a large sandy beach, dunes, quaint fishermen's cottages, local shops, and a variety of pubs and restaurants.
The region is particularly appealing to walkers and cyclists, with the renowned Tarka Trail offering scenic routes for exploration. North Devon is home to some of the country's most beautiful beaches, including Croyde and Woolacombe, known for their excellent surf conditions. Additionally, visitors can discover smaller coves and bays, as well as the nearby Exmoor and Dartmoor National Parks, which provide breathtaking landscapes and diverse wildlife. The South West Coastal Path also runs close by, offering stunning coastal views.
